Deep Magic Volume 2 (p.199)
Mass Contagious Healing
7-level Evocation
Casting Time: 1 action
Range/Area: 60ft.
Components: Verbal, Somatic
Duration: 1 minute
Damage/Effect: Healing
A wave of magical disease washes out from a point of your choice within range. Choose up to three creatures in a 30-foot-radius sphere centered on that point. Each target is infected by a magical disease and regains hit points equal to 3d8 + your spellcasting ability modifier.
The next time an infected target takes damage, the disease ends on the target and infects a new friendly creature within 10 feet of the first. The new target regains hit points equal to 2d8 + your spellcasting ability modifier. The next time the new target takes damage, the disease ends on it and moves to another friendly creature within 10 feet of it. The disease continues moving from target to target in this way, reducing the amount of healing by 1d8 each time the disease moves to a new target. The final target regains hit points equal to 1d8 + your spellcasting ability modifier and that instance of the disease ends.
This spell ends early if all instances of the disease end. A creature can be healed multiple times by this spell but can have only one instance of the disease on it at a time. If a creature already has an instance of this disease and would gain another, the previous instance of the disease immediately moves to another valid target as if the creature had taken damage. This spell has no effect on Undead or Constructs.
At higher levels: When you cast this spell using a spell slot of 8th-level or higher, the healing increases by 1d8 for each slot level above 7th.
Available for: Bard, Cleric, Druid
